About Bernard Springer
Bernard Springer is a scholar working on Mechanical Engineering, Condensed Matter Physics, Ceramics and Composites, Materials Chemistry and Atomic and Molecular Physics, and Optics, having authored 4 papers that have together received 54 indexed citations. Recurring topics across this work include Thermodynamic and Structural Properties of Metals and Alloys (3 papers), Material Dynamics and Properties (2 papers), Glass properties and applications (2 papers), Theoretical and Computational Physics (2 papers), Surface and Thin Film Phenomena (1 paper), Plasma Diagnostics and Applications (1 paper) and Electrohydrodynamics and Fluid Dynamics (1 paper). The work is most often cited by research in Geophysics (22 citations), General Materials Science (4 citations), Mechanical Engineering (39 citations), Atomic and Molecular Physics, and Optics (21 citations) and Ceramics and Composites (3 citations). Bernard Springer has collaborated with scholars based in United States. Frequent co-authors include R.A. Gerwin and J. E. Drummond. Their work appears in journals such as Journal of Nuclear Energy Part C Plasma Physics Accelerators Thermonuclear Research and Physical Review.
